Vote no on the SAVE Act. This bill is an unconstitutional poll tax that will disproportionately disenfranchise women voters.
Requiring documentary proof of citizenship to register to vote creates the exact barrier the 24th Amendment prohibits. Millions of Americans, particularly women who have changed their names through marriage, lack easy access to birth certificates or naturalization papers. Obtaining these documents costs money and time that many working families don't have. That's a poll tax by another name.
Women are hit hardest by this requirement. One in three women of voting age don't have documentation that reflects their current legal name. After the 19th Amendment finally guaranteed women the right to vote in 1920, we shouldn't pass laws that functionally reverse that progress by making it harder for women to register.
We already have systems to verify citizenship. States cross-check voter rolls against DMV records and Social Security databases. Noncitizen voting is vanishingly rare because the penalties are severe: deportation and permanent bars to citizenship. The SAVE Act solves a problem that doesn't exist while creating real barriers for eligible citizens.
Protect every American's right to vote. Oppose the SAVE Act.
